Output 02309704fc682e44ae24d8ea989f78a85bb96279fc71b8163bd202d30b9630e6:14

value
6950000
script pubkey
OP_0 OP_PUSHBYTES_20 3ad51ea62f5d9513d44a88a5a78acf58e29e7190
address
bc1q8t23af30tk2384z23zj60zk0tr3fuuvsk8ey5f
transaction
02309704fc682e44ae24d8ea989f78a85bb96279fc71b8163bd202d30b9630e6